Weasels, Stoats or possibly depending on where you live Minks - as pointed out earlier NOT a raccoon in the UK.

Weasels are hard to see, they are so small. Even stoats are only likely to be seen darting across a road. They both shoot about in undergrowth at an alarming speed.

Weasels will get through less than a 1 inch hole, Stoats can probably manage to get through a 1 inch hole, Minks are a bit bigger.
